What exactly is roof pitch?

Roof pitch is the steepness of a roof, expressed as an angle in degrees or as a ratio of rise to run. UK uses degrees (e.g. 35°). US uses rise/run (e.g. 6:12 = 6 inches rise per 12 inches run). Both describe the same thing.

Degrees vs ratio conversion

To convert ratio to degrees: pitch° = arctan(rise ÷ run). A 6:12 roof = arctan(0.5) = 26.57°. To convert degrees to ratio: tan(pitch°). At 35°, tan(35) = 0.700, so the ratio is ~7:10.

Why pitch matters for materials

Pitch determines roof surface area. The pitch factor (1 ÷ cos(pitch°)) converts plan area to actual roof area. At 35°, the factor is 1.221 - 100 m² plan becomes 122.1 m² of roof surface.

Minimum pitch by material

Concrete/clay tiles need 17.5°+ in UK; metal standing seam 3°+; slate 20°+; felt/membrane flat roofs need 1:80 fall (~0.7°). Below minimums, water ponds and penetrates.

Formulas used

Pitch from rise/run

pitch° = arctan(rise ÷ run)

Rise/run from pitch

ratio = tan(pitch°)

Pitch as percentage

percent = (rise ÷ run) × 100

Pitch factor

factor = 1 ÷ cos(pitch°)

Worked example: 6:12 roof, converting to degrees, percentage and surface area

  1. 1Ratio 6:12 means 6 units of rise per 12 units of run
  2. 2Degrees: arctan(6 / 12) = arctan(0.5) = 26.57°
  3. 3Percentage: 0.5 × 100 = 50%
  4. 4Pitch factor: 1 / cos(26.57°) = 1.118
  5. 5A 100 m² plan roof at this pitch: 100 × 1.118 = 111.8 m² of roof surface
  6. 6Ordering materials for the surface area, not the plan area, avoids shortfalls

Assumptions & limitations

  • Pitch is measured from the horizontal (run), not the rafter length.
  • The pitch factor converts plan (footprint) area to actual roof surface area. It assumes a single uniform pitch.
  • Hipped roofs with multiple pitches need each plane calculated separately.
  • Minimum pitch rules vary by material and manufacturer - always check the product datasheet.

Frequently asked questions

How do I calculate roof pitch in degrees?

Measure rise over a known run (e.g. 300mm over 1000mm) and calculate arctan(0.3) = 16.7°. Or use a digital level on the roof surface.

What is a 6:12 pitch in degrees?

arctan(6/12) = 26.57°. One of the most common US residential roof pitches.

What pitch factor should I use?

1 ÷ cos(pitch°). At 25° = 1.103, at 35° = 1.221, at 45° = 1.414. Multiply plan area by this factor for actual roof surface area.
